Recording the details of an accident
If you're involved in an auto accident, it is imperative to document the details of the accident. It is vital to document the damage to your vehicle in order to prove your insurance claim. It is essential to gather the most evidence you can to show your side of the story. Even minor accidents can cause thousands of dollars of damage.
A police report is not sufficient to establish liability. You must also have detailed details from both parties. You might be able prove the guilt of the other person by providing detailed information in the accident report. An example of this is a vehicle's history of service. This allows investigators to determine the role of the vehicle in the accident. Similar to the record of service for an airplane. This will help them determine worn-out parts or special components. Another crucial element of evidence is a 911 dispatch call. It will provide a full account of the incident and the individuals who were involved.
Photograph the accident scene and take photos of the damage to your vehicle as well as the other vehicle. Photographing the damage can aid in the preparation of an insurance claim. Also, take note of the other driver's license plate when it is visible. You might also be able to locate witnesses on the scene.
You should also seek medical attention if injured during the accident. Even minor injuries shouldn't be ignored. The failure to treat these injuries can have serious implications for your health. Also, getting medical attention can help you keep track of your injuries and link them to the incident. This is essential for investigators to determine who is accountable.
It is essential to record the details of an auto accident, particularly when you are at fault. The documentation of the details of an accident will assist you in avoiding liability and also ensure your safety. For instance the police report will include statements from witnesses. Make sure to get as many details as you can, and you might be able to capture images of documents to document the incident.
Photographs are important documentation of an auto accident. When you're at the scene, be sure to bring a disposable camera. You should not only take photos of the cars involved in the accident but also photos of any road damage. These photos will be useful to investigators reconstructing the accident.
It is essential to keep track of the details from an auto accident. This will not only keep your memories of the accident fresh but you could also use them as evidence in a lawsuit, if it is necessary. It will also give you more credibility and worth for the case if you record the details of the incident in writing.
